Nerja becomes the next town in the Axarquía to penalize ‘beach hoggers’.

Torrox, Algarrobo, and now Nerja follow its other European counterparts in imposing fines on those caught using their belongings to reserve and save the best beach spots for an extended period of time. Ones will soon be penalized if caught leaving chairs or parasols etc to reserve prime areas on the beach. The idea behind such deterrents is to prevent noted issues such as arguments between rival sun bathers, with some even going as far as to cause violent confrontations.

On the list of actions resulting in fines from the town hall are, creating sculptures in the sand without permission, camping and building fires on the beach. These among other local laws are expected to be in place and carried out before next summer!
